• Home
  • Local SEO
  • Optimizing Your Website for Local SEO: A Complete Checklist
Optimizing Your Website for Local SEO A Complete Checklist

Optimizing Your Website for Local SEO: A Complete Checklist

For any business with a physical location, having an effective local SEO strategy is essential for driving more foot traffic, phone calls, and sales. Local SEO improves your visibility when customers search for products or services near them on Google, Bing and other search engines.

But optimizing your website fully for local SEO involves much more than just targeting a few local keywords. Many elements across your site need to be optimized to signal relevance and authority in local search results.

In this comprehensive guide, I’ll walk through a complete checklist of factors to optimize on your website for local SEO success.

Conduct Local Keyword Research

The first step is researching keywords and phrases your potential local customers are searching for.

Identify generic terms like “pizza Chicago” along with longer, more specific variations like “south loop deep dish pizza restaurants open late.”

Use tools like:

  • Google Keyword Planner – Shows local monthly search volume data.
  • Ubersuggest – Generates location-based keyword ideas.
  • Google Trends – Reveals search trends for city names.
  • Google Autocomplete – Shows common local searches.

Make a list of target keywords to optimize for each page.

Optimize Title Tags

Incorporate your most important local keywords into page title tags where it fits naturally.

Format like:

“{Key keyword} in {city name} | {Business name}”

Include Location in Headers

Work your city, neighborhood or region name into H1 and H2 header tags to indicate location relevance.

Meta Descriptions

Mention your location in page meta descriptions along with keywords.

URL Structure

If possible, add your city name or zip code into page URLs:

  • www.businessname.com/chicago/services
  • www.businessname.com/75201/contact-us

Content

Naturally, work location names and keywords into page content. Write locally-focused blogs like neighborhood guides.

Image Alt Text

Include keywords and location names in alt text descriptions for images.

Local Schema Markup

Use LocalBusiness, GeoCoordinates and other local schema markup. This enhances how Google displays your business info in local pack listings.

Contact Info

List your business name, full address, phone number and other contact details on every page.

Internal Linking

Link internally between location-based pages on your site using geo-targeted anchor text.

Earn links from newspaper sites, directories, local organizations and location-specific sites.

Social Profiles

Ensure your business name, address and phone number are consistent across all social profiles.

Google My Business

Fully complete your Google My Business profile with photos, description, services, hours, etc.

Online Listings

Claim and optimize your listings on directories like Yelp, Yellow Pages, Facebook and industry-specific sites.

Reviews

Collect and monitor customer reviews on Google, Facebook, Yelp and other platforms. Respond professionally.

Mobile Optimization

Ensure your website is mobile-friendly and loads fast on mobile devices. This is critical for local SEO.

Analytics

Track website traffic, conversions, rankings and other metrics to gauge local SEO performance.

Consider paid search and social campaigns geo-targeted to your locations.

Optimize key elements on your website to attract local customers looking for your products and services. Monitor your local SEO progress and refine your strategy over time.

What local SEO tactics have you found to be most effective? Let me know in the comments!

References

[1] https://moz.com/blog/local-seo-checklist

[2] https://www.brightlocal.com/learn/local-seo-checklist/

[3] https://www.searchenginejournal.com/local-seo-guide/on-page-optimization/

[4] https://www.lyfemarketing.com/blog/local-seo-checklist/

[5] https://www.webfx.com/blog/seo/local-seo-checklist/

[6] https://backlinko.com/local-seo-checklist

Post List #3

what are local directories in seo

Unlocking the Power of Local Directories for SEO Success

Marc LaClearFeb 14, 20247 min read

In the digital age, where the internet is the first stop for most customers looking for products or services, local businesses can’t afford to overlook the importance of online visibility. One of the most effective ways to boost this visibility…

How Long Does Local SEO Really Take? A Comprehensive Timeline…

How Long Does Local SEO Really Take? A Comprehensive Timeline…

Marc LaClearJan 4, 202420 min read

Imagine this scenario: You’ve eagerly rubbed the magic SEO lamp, your heart set on watching that genie emerge to bestow upon your website those coveted top local search rankings. Yet as time marches on, you’re left with a nagging suspicion…

Creating Compelling Local Landing Pages That Convert

Creating Compelling Local Landing Pages That Convert

Marc LaClearDec 24, 20236 min read

As a business with a physical location, having a website that connects with customers in your geographic area is critical for driving foot traffic and sales. A practical approach to improve your local online visibility is by creating dedicated landing…

How to Use Google Maps for Local SEO

How to Use Google Maps for Local SEO

Marc LaClearDec 23, 20235 min read

For any business with a physical location, ranking highly on Google Maps is critical for driving foot traffic and sales. Google Maps has become the go-to resource for consumers to discover and research local businesses. In fact, according to a…

How to Leverage Google Q&A for More Local Traffic

How to Leverage Google Q&A for More Local Traffic

Marc LaClearDec 6, 20236 min read

Google’s Q&A feature allows users to ask questions and see featured answers directly in Google search results. For local businesses, optimizing Google Q&A can be a highly effective tactic for driving more relevant traffic from local searchers. In this comprehensive…